Check Tyler Tool first. I was doing an internet search for best price on a Dewalt planer stand. CPO was priced at $165.00 with free shipping. Tyler Tool ( I had no idea they were the same company, but identical web page formats was my first hint) had it for $150 with free shipping. A few clicks and I discovered Tyler was bought out by CPO a while back.
Going to start doing a lot more comparisons between the two now on.
